Extravagant forms of iron accouterments, held as dance staffs or worn as adornment, have been used by communities in coming-of-age ceremonies and to mark the transition from adulthood to death (and ancestor status). Fowler Museum director and exhibition co-curator Marla C. Berns links these transformative events to the blacksmith’s processes, looking at an array of forged works from West and Central Africa on view in Striking Iron.
